CURRICULUM VITAE<br />
Name: Tiit Lauk<br />
Date and place of birth: 09.01.1948, Tartu<br />
Citizenship: Estonian<br />
Education<br />
2003 Master’s studies in the Jazz Department of the Estonian Music Academy/<br />
Sibelius Academy, Master of Music Pedagogy<br />
1979 Tallinn State Conservatoire, piano<br />
1974 G. Ots Tallinn Music College, piano<br />
Work Experience<br />
2003– Tallinn University, extraordinary lecturer<br />
2001– Tallinn Music School, extraordinary lecturer<br />
1997–2001 Freelance musician<br />
1993–1997 Managing director of the Estonian Jazz Foundation<br />
1990–1995 Vice president of the Estonian Jazz Union, managing director; financial director of the<br />
Jazzkaar international jazz festival<br />
1989–1990 Musical manager of the Cultural Cooperative ‘Aara’, G. Ots Music College lecturer<br />
1987–1989 Music producer in the Estonian Broadcasting Company<br />
1985–1987 Head of Music Department of the Scientific Research Centre of Estonian Folk Culture,<br />
chairman of the Estonian Republican Rating Committee<br />
1977–1985 Tallinn Pedagogical College, lecturer<br />
1974–1979 Piano/arrangements in various bands/orchestras in Tallinn (Vana Toomas, Lexicon etc.)<br />
1963–1974 Piano/arrangements (since 1968 conductor) in the dance orchestra of the Tartu State<br />
University club<br />
Professional Development<br />
IASJ international summer schools in Sienna (2007) and Helsinki (2002)<br />
IASJ 1 st International Jazz Teaching Conference in the Royal Hague Conservatoire (2004)<br />
Training course in jazz piano teaching in Stadia College in Helsinki (2003)<br />
Seminar “Jazz and its Teaching in Europe and America”, Grenoble (1995)<br />
Prof. Bob Brookmeyer’s improvisation master class in the Amsterdam Summer University (1993)<br />
Interpreter’s Activities<br />
Since 1970 has participated at more than 20 music and jazz festivals in the former Soviet Union and in<br />
Europe together with most of Estonian top jazz musicians (L. Saarsalu, S. Vrait, T. Unt, etc.) as well<br />
as with well-known foreign musicians (Francis Jauvain, Maurice Jennings, Ron Humphries); concerts<br />
together with the Italian star Roberto Loretti<br />
Numerous recordings for the Estonian Radio<br />
MC “Let’s Meet at Jazzkaar” (1995) and MC “JAZZ PENDEL” (1998)<br />
Serious music concert tours with top soloists M. Palm, T. Maiste, V. Kuslap, V. Puura, E. Otsman in<br />
Sweden, Finland, USA, France, Czech Republic, Poland, Lithuania, Latvia<br />
Concerts in Estonia together with both singers and T. Saviauk (flute), P. Bernhardt (violin), A. Villenthal<br />
(double-bass)<br />
As a serious music soloist, T. Lauk has performed the solo piano version of G. Gershwin’s “Rhapsody<br />
in Blue” in Estonia (11 times), Krakow and Helsinki (Arts Night Programme, 2005)<br />
Every month some 3–5 public performances with various programmes both as a soloist as well as in<br />
bands<br />
